Latest Patents
Chai Eong Boo holds a patent for a wireless enhanced projector (WEP). This innovative invention encompasses techniques that allow one or more devices, such as mobile phones, smartphones, personal digital assistants, and tablet computers, to utilize the WEP. The devices connect to the WEP via a server device that can be integrated with the projector. A unique feature of this invention is that at least one device can operate as a super-user or moderator, enabling a seamless and interactive experience for users.
